The general rule of thumb is the more RAM you have installed, the more tasks the machine can perform simultaneously without issue. Judy Hough's message refers to RAM memory, not storage memory. RAM serves as space kept aside for helping programs and other hardware- and software-related tasks function without hiccups within the operating system environment.
